It sounds like you had a Pap smear and the doctor told you you have some atypical (cells that are not normal) from your cervix. These cells are not cancer, but could turn into cancer. High-grade cellular changes are more likely to turn into cancer than low-grade ones. This is called cervical dysplasia.
Here are some treatments for this condition: (the risk of infertility with these procedures is probably small). They do not remove the uterus, just the abnormal tissue. There may be some increased risk of preterm delivery in a future pregnancy.
LEEP (loop electrosurgical excision procedure) uses an electrical current that is passed through a thin wire loop to act as a knife to remove tissue. These treatments usually fix the problem but followup exams are necessary as it may or may not come back.
Cryotherapy destroys abnormal tissue by freezing it.
Laser therapy uses a narrow beam of intense light to destroy or remove abnormal cells.
Conization removes a cone-shaped piece of tissue using a knife, a laser, or the LEEP technique.
If you actually have cervical cancer, in the early stages some women may have surgery that preserves fertility - it's called a trachelectomy. It's not right for everyone though.
